Ophthalmologic Surgery 261QS0132X
Ophthalmologic Surgery: Is the study of the eye and the medical and surgical treatment of the related disorders. This type of surgery uses a variety of stainless steel and titanium instruments. Cataract surgery is the most common type of Ophthalmologic Surgery.
